Last Listing description (September 2018)

Beautifully set on a large elevated 1151m2 allotment boasting views of the lake across to Newlands Arm and just an easy stroll to lake. Open plan living with split system and wood heater with sliding doors out to a large deck which take in the views. Two bedrooms, master with WIR and powder room, sitting room, bathroom/laundry and detached studio which is lined and carpeted. 6m x 6m c/b garage (roller door for access to rear yard) and garden shed. The north facing rear garden provides a beautiful retreat with its easy care native garden and gazebo perfect for year round outdoor entertaining. Only one neighbour, public reserve on other side and rural property at rear.

About Paynesville 3880

The size of Paynesville is approximately 7.0 square kilometres. There are 8 parks, covering nearly 3.7% of the total area. The population of Paynesville in 2016 was 3480 people. By 2021 the population was 3636 showing a population growth of 4.5%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Paynesville is 70-79 years. Households in Paynesville are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Paynesville work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 76.30% of the homes in Paynesville were owner-occupied compared with 71.50% in 2016.

Paynesville has 3,379 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Paynesville have seen a 15.22%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 17.36% increase. As at 31 August 2026:

  • The median value for Houses in Paynesville is $595,888 while the median value for Units is $387,576.
  • Houses have a median rent of $500 while Units have a median rent of $390.
There are currently 76 properties listed for sale, and 15 properties listed for rent in Paynesville on OnTheHouse. According to Cotality's data, 183 properties were sold in the past 12 months in Paynesville.
